About Electroplating gi wire
Electroplating GI (Galvanized Iron) wire is a process used to apply a thin, uniform zinc coating to a steel wire core for corrosion resistance and a smoother, brighter finish. This differs from hot-dip galvanization, which creates a thicker, more durable coating

Q: What is the process involved in electroplating GI wires?
A: The electroplating process involves immersing GI wires into a solution containing metal ions, then applying an electric current. This deposits a protective metallic layer onto the wire, significantly improving its surface protection against environmental factors.
